Calculate first, second, and third derivative values for function, f (x) = -x2 + 5x + 3 at points x = -2,0, 2 by "less and more accurate" forward, backward, and centered difference approximations. Calculate relative resiudal error between this values and exact values. (Use step size 0.2, if you already calculated the results with another step size, it is also accepted),
